  • Patent number: 10796510
    Abstract: Apparatuses, systems and methods monitor vehicular activity. Specifically, the apparatuses, systems, and methods of the present disclosure provide a plurality of sensors and devices for monitoring a vehicle while the vehicle is in use, including but not limited to, impact sensors, cameras, recording devices, and other like devices. Even more specifically, multiple vehicles having the apparatuses, systems, and methods of the present disclosure may be networked together to provide multiple fields of view. The devices create data streams that are processed and/or recorded for reference to the same upon inquiry, such as after a vehicle accident or for any other purpose. The data streams from multiple vehicles are combined to provide additional details undiscoverable when using a single source.

  • Publication number: 20140178532
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a beverage mixing apparatus. Specifically, the present invention relates to a filter containing coffee, tea, or another additive to be mixed with a liquid. The filter is formed into a ball and attached to a rigid stick for stirring and mixing the contents of the present invention into a liquid. The filter may keep solid beverage additives separate from the liquid while still allowing the two to mix. Soluble additives may pass freely through the filter.
